Ginkgo biloba, commonly known as ginkgo or gingko (both pronounced /ˈɡɪŋkoʊ/), also known as the maidenhair tree, is the only living species in the division Ginkgophyta, all others being extinct. It is found in fossils dating back 270 million years.

Method for preparing biological activated carbon from waste maidenhair tree leaves and folium ginkgo herb residue

The invention discloses a method for preparing biological activated carbon from waste maidenhair tree leaves and folium ginkgo herb residue. The method comprises the following steps: washing the maidenhair tree leaves or the folium ginkgo herb residue with water for several times till the washed water is clear, so as to obtain materials I; washing the materials I with distilled water, so as to obtain materials II; mixing the materials II with an activating agent solution; carrying out impregnating for 2 to 24 hours at the room temperature; putting into a muffle furnace; heating to 300 to 800 DEG C; carbonizing for 0.5 to 3 hours; cooling to the room temperature; washing with a hydrochloric acid solution; washing with distilled water to obtain a neutral semi-product; drying the semi-product; grinding the dried semi-product to obtain the biological activated carbon. The method has the advantages that the preparation technology is simple, clean and environment-friendly; the cost is low; not only is waste changed into valuable, but also the obtained biological activated carbon is uniform in texture, large in pore space, relatively large in specific surface area, and excellent in capability of adsorbing organic pollutants (such as methylene blue and phenol) and heavy metal ions (Cu<2+>), and can be applied to the technical field of industrial wastewater treatment.

Grafting method by taking maidenhair tree root system as stock

The invention belongs to the technical field of plant cultivation, and particularly relates to a grafting method by utilizing maidenhair tree roots as stock so as to improve maidenhair tree reproduction. The method is characterized by comprising the following steps: (1) taking a selected grafting stock plantlet trunk as the center, semi-cutting the root system along the periphery with the radius of 0.5-1m, wherein the hair roots are not cut off as much as possible; (2) taking a main root as stock and remaining shoot roots, cutting off one second root at an interval of one, selecting a root system of 0.5-2.0cm, or selecting second roots with two main roots; (3) lifting the cut root system to be 5cm above the ground, backfilling the dug root soil and stepping on the soil, and straightening the selected grafting stock root with soil; (4) performing grafting after the stock root is grafted for 4-6 hours when water on the cut surface does not exude. According to the grafting method, the cleft grafting method and the cut-grafting method are adopted. The method disclosed by the invention has the benefits that the maidenhair tree reproduction efficiency is improved, and the survival rate is improved to be 98.2%.

Rapid seedling method for maidenhair trees

The invention provides a rapid seedling method for maidenhair trees, and relates to the technical field of nursery stock breeding. The method includes the following steps of: (1) soil improvement: turning over a land to be sown, and evenly applying a soil improvement agent to the surface of soil after turning over, wherein the amount of the soil improvement agent is 85 Kg per mu, a rotary cultivator can be used to smash and level the soil, and the leveled land can be used to sow; (2) seed germination accelerating: selecting seeds during early and middle of February, and putting the selected seeds into an insulating germination accelerating box to accelerate germination, wherein the seeds can be used to sow when the length of the radicle is identical to that of a seed stone; (3) sowing: completing sowing before spring equinox and sowing 2.5 ten thousand stains of seedlings per mu; and (4) management after sowing: keeping a seedbed wet before seedlings come up out from the ground, and managing the seedlings by adoption of the conventional method after seedling hardening. According to the rapid seedling method for the maidenhair trees, the sprouting rate of the seeds can be improved, the improved soil is loose and breathable, and the fertilizer maintenance ability is high; the growing period is prolonged, the growing speeds of roots and stems of the seedlings are fast, and the rapid seedling method for the maidenhair trees can improve the economic benefits of maidenhair seedling.

Transplanting method of maidenhair trees with multiple branches

The invention relates to a transplanting method of maidenhair trees with multiple branches. The method includes the steps of digging operation, wherein an annular machine base is installed around eachmaidenhair tree with multiple branches, a rotating mechanism on the machine base drives a suspension arm to rotate, a spader on the front end of each suspension arm is driven by a hydraulic oil cylinder to achieve digging, and a screw-in mechanism can fix the corresponding machine base to the ground; packaging and hoisting, wherein soil balls after excavation and shaping are packed and wrapped tightly and densely by hemp ropes; the hemp rope layers are wrapped by straw ropes after the straw ropes are soaked in a nutrient solution, the straw ropes are tightly and densely wrapped by shrinkabletape, the outer most layers of the wrapped soil balls are covered by tuck nets, and then the soil balls are hoisted from the ground by corresponding lifting hooks; transport operation, wherein the hoisted soil balls are placed in a soil ball container on a transport vehicle; transplanting management, wherein root fixing water is sprayed once every week, clean water is sprayed five weeks later, andafter transplanting, nitrogenous fertilizer is applied once separately after four months, five months and six months. According to the transplanting method of the maidenhair trees with the branches,by decreasing or increasing the quantity of the machine bases, the range of a digging area can be adjusted, the transplanting method is applicable to maidenhair trees which are different in age limitand size and have multiple branches, can effectively protect the root systems of the maidenhair trees and greatly increase the survival rate of transplanting.

Inserted type biological fertilizer box used for maidenhair tree

The invention discloses an inserted type biological fertilizer box used for a maidenhair tree. The biological fertilizer box can be directly inserted into soil around roots of the maidenhair tree for fertilization. Fallen leaves of the maidenhair tree are minced and decayed and then are mixed with cane trash, organic fertilizer, loam and ice cubes, and then earthworms are added into the mixture, so that a filling fertilizer is formed. Afterwards, the filling fertilizer is loaded into a conical shell, and then the biological fertilizer box can be inserted into the soft soil around the roots of the maidenhair tree to achieve fertilization. As through holes are formed in the conical shell, the earthworms can move around the roots of the maidenhair tree outside the conical shell to perform soil loosening and other activities which are beneficial to the soil, and fertilization and soil loosening can be achieved at the same time. In addition, the biological fertilizer box is quite convenient to use, and nutrients contained in the filling fertilizer are the closest to the requirements of the maidenhair tree. Besides, the holes are further formed in the conical shell, other fertilizer can be added regularly or irregularly, the biological fertilizer box directly acts on the roots of the maidenhair tree for fertilization, and therefore the fertilizer combination is novel.

Maidenhair-tree winter anti-freezing method

The invention discloses a maidenhair-tree winter anti-freezing method. The maidenhair-tree winter anti-freezing method is characterized by including the following steps that a maidenhair tree serves as a center, in the range of a circle of which the radius is 9-12 cm, a pit of which the depth is 12-14 cm is dug, and the bottom of the pit is leveled; prepared root anti-freezing nutrient gel is poured into the bottom of the pit to form a gel layer of which the depth is 0.2-0.3 cm, soil is used for covering the pit and leveled up; maidenhair-tree trunk is protected, firstly, a 8-mesh cotton web is adopted to wrap part of the portion, from the root part to a part which is 1.2-1.5 m away from the trunk, of the maidenhair tree, trunk anti-freezing nutrient gel is adopted to coat the portion, covered by the cotton web, of trunk, and the depth of a trunk nutrient gel layer is about 0.15-0.3 cm, then, limewater is used, and the portion, covered by the cotton web, of the trunk is painted to be white.

Formula for producing special blending fertilizer for maidenhair tree by combining calcium magnesium phosphate powder with fertilizer source of granular superphosphate

The invention discloses a formula for producing a special blending fertilizer for maidenhair tree by combining a calcium magnesium phosphate powder with a fertilizer source of urea. The invention is characterized in that: according to the fertilizer requirement regularity of maidenhair trees, the calcium magnesium phosphate powder is combined with fertilizer sources of granular superphosphate and urea to form a layer of calcium magnesium phosphate film on the granular surface; the special blending fertilizer not only prevents the deliquescing phenomenon caused by direct contact of superphosphate with urea, but also can reduce phosphorus fixation and utilization of slow release nitrogen when applied into soil; furthermore, the calcium magnesium phosphate fertilizer contains medium trace elements essential to crop growth, and is truly a multi-element compound fertilizer. 0.9-1.1 parts of high quality calcium magnesium phosphate powder, 4.4-4.6 parts of combination urea, 0.4-0.6 part of monoammonium phosphate, 2.4-2.6 parts of granular superphosphate and 1.4-1.6 parts of potassium chloride are subjected to dry mixing and blending and packaging by bags, and the product is launched in the market and used for production; and the blending fertilizer contains 38% of total nutrients of nitrogen, phosphorus and potassium, wherein the three are in the ratio of 21:8:9.
